Reading Romans in community

Off to lead a bible study on Romans, slightly fearful of dishing up yet more gobbets of information for people to process.

I'm hoping to avoid this by earthing the text in the real lives of its original hearers (with the help of Peter Oakes' excellent new book Reading Romans in Pompeii) and thence in our lives. I'm also hoping that the learning will be mutual, with everyone there sharing their insights.

First, I have to get over the hurdle of everyone thinking that Romans is only and all about how God puts individuals right with himself. But mine are an intelligent bunch, so this shouldn't be too difficult.
